Enhancing AI agents with long-term memory: Insights into LangMem SDK, Memobase and the A-MEM Framework

AI agents can automate many tasks that enterprises want to perform. One downside, though, is that they tend to be forgetful. Without long-term memory, agents must either finish a task in a single session or be constantly re-prompted.
